WESTMINSTER, Md. – McDaniel will travel to Gettysburg, Pa., to take on Gettysburg in the first-round of the 2015 Centennial Conference (CC) men's basketball championship on Wednesday. Game time is 7:30 p.m.
The fifth-seeded Green Terror (14-11, 9-9 CC) faces the fourth-seeded Bullets (14-11, 10-8 CC). The winner advances to Friday's semifinals at top-seeded Johns Hopkins (22-3, 16-2 CC) in the day's second semifinal.
The day's first semifinal pits second-seeded Franklin & Marshall (20-5, 13-5 CC) against third-seeded Dickinson (20-5, 13-5 CC), slated to begin at 6 p.m. The day's second semifinal will begin at 8 p.m. or 30 minutes following the conclusion of game one.
The championship game will held on Saturday at 7 p.m.
Admission for all games is $5 for adults and $3 for students. Youths 12 and under as well as students from participating institutions, who present their ID, are free.
The tournament's champion will earn the CC's automatic bid to the 2015 NCAA Division III tournament, slated to begin on Thursday, Mar. 5. The NCAA field will be announced on Monday at 12:30 p.m.
McDaniel is seeking its first CC championship and berth in the NCAA tournament.
Tim Stewart (Smyrna, Del./Smyrna) leads the team in scoring (15.6 ppg) and rebounding (6.4 rpg). He also has 33 assists.
Phillip Perry (Crownsville, Md./Annapolis Area Christian) and Andrew Merlo (Rehoboth, Del./Cape Henlopen) are tied for second on the team in scoring (7.4 ppg). Perry is second on the squad with 40 steals. Merlo leads the team with 47 assists.
Wes Brooks (North Wales, Pa./North Penn) has a team-best 41 steals while ranking second with 46 assists. He also has a team-best 40 3-pointers.
